Royal Enfield Meteor 350 Launched in India

November 6, 2020 by Azaman Chothia Leave a Comment

The Royal Enfield Meteor 350 has finally been launched in India and has been priced between Rs 1.75 lakh and Rs 1.90 lakh (ex-showroom prices).

The Royal Enfield Meteor 350 has been spotted testing for quite a while now and there has been a lot of hype with regards to the launch of this model. The motorcycle is based on the company’s brand-new J-platform and this BS6 model will replace the Royal Enfield Thunderbird 350 X. There will be three variants on offer – the entry variant is called the Fireball, followed by the Stellar and finally the top-end Supernova variant.

The Royal Enfield Meteor 350 looks similar to the Thunderbird X and has retained most of the ergonomics with a raised handlebar, wide seat, and foot-pegs that have been set forward. The Royal Enfield Meteor 350 has been developed with a new BS6, 349-cc, single-cylinder, air-cooled, fuel-injected engine which puts out 20.5 hp at 6,100 rpm and a peak torque of 27 Nm at 4,000 rpm.

The bike uses a twin-downtube spine frame chassis and the suspension setup comprises a 41-mm fork at the front and twin-tube shock absorbers with six-step adjustable preload at the rear. The braking hardware used on the motorcycle is a 300-mm disc at the front and a 270-mm disc at the rear with dual-channel ABS.

Other features that can be seen are a twin-pod instrument cluster, a ring-shaped LED DRL around the headlight and alloy wheels (19-inch front and 17-inch rear). The new Royal Enfield Meteor 350 will be available with a whole bunch of accessories and customization options including things like a windshield, panniers, custom footpegs, seat options, and much more. The bike will also get over 15 tank colour options to choose from.

The Thunderbird 350X was priced at Rs 1.63 lakh (ex-showroom) and this marks an increase of Rs 12,000 for the entry-level Fireball variant. This price hike was expected considering the BS6 engine and all the new features on offer. The Meteor 350 will rival the likes of the Jawa and Benelli Imperiale 400.

Price List (ex-showroom Chennai)
Royal Enfield Meteor 350 Fireball – Rs 1,75,825
Royal Enfield Meteor 350 Stellar – Rs 1,81,342
Royal Enfield Meteor 350 Supernova – Rs 1,90,536
